As a handballer John O'Neill enjoyed national fame. He had no peers. At this form of sport also Thomas Dalton Kilmanahan and Mick Butler Carriggnaug excelled of people who walked from Owning to Kilkenny and back again in a single day there are local accounts Garret Byrne, Paddy Byrne, and Paul Power where powerful long distance swimmers.
